Shure SRH840 Headphones Specification

The Shure SRH840 headphones are designed for professional audio engineers and musicians, offering precision and comfort for critical listening and studio monitoring. These closed-back, circumaural headphones are engineered with 40mm neodymium dynamic drivers, providing a frequency response range of 5Hz to 25kHz. This ensures an accurate and extended audio reproduction across the spectrum, catering to the demands of professional audio applications.

The SRH840 features an impedance of 44 ohms and a sensitivity of 102 dB/mW, making them compatible with a wide range of audio devices without the need for additional amplification. The headphones employ a coiled, detachable cable that extends up to 3 meters, offering flexibility and durability for both studio and mobile use. The cable is equipped with a gold-plated 3.5mm stereo mini-jack and a threaded 6.3mm gold-plated adapter for secure connectivity.

Comfort is prioritized with the SRH840, featuring an adjustable padded headband and replaceable ear pads that provide a snug fit, minimizing ear fatigue during extended sessions. The headphones are designed to fold flat for convenient storage and transport, making them suitable for on-the-go professionals. At a weight of approximately 372 grams without the cable, these headphones balance sturdiness with portability.

The SRH840's build quality is robust, incorporating high-quality materials to withstand the rigors of daily professional use. Shure's attention to detail ensures reliability and longevity, aligning with their reputation for producing industry-standard audio equipment. Shure SRH840 Headphones F.A.Q.

How do I properly connect the Shure SRH840 headphones to my audio device?

To connect the Shure SRH840 headphones, plug the 3.5mm connector into the audio output of your device. If your device has a 1/4" output, use the included adapter to ensure compatibility.

What is the best way to clean and maintain the Shure SRH840 headphones?

To clean your SRH840 headphones, use a soft, dry cloth to wipe the ear pads and headband. Avoid using any liquids or cleaning solutions. Regularly check for debris in the ear cups and clean carefully with a dry brush if necessary.

How can I replace the ear pads on my Shure SRH840 headphones?

To replace the ear pads, gently pull the old pads away from the ear cups. Align the new pads with the mounting flange and press firmly around the edges until they snap into place.

What should I do if there is no sound coming from my Shure SRH840 headphones?

First, check the connection to ensure the plug is fully inserted. Test the headphones with another device to rule out a faulty audio source. If the problem persists, inspect the cable for damage and consider replacing it if necessary.

How do I adjust the headband on the Shure SRH840 for a better fit?

To adjust the headband, gently pull or push the ear cups along the headband's track until you achieve a comfortable fit. The headband is designed to accommodate various head sizes for optimal comfort.

What is the recommended way to store Shure SRH840 headphones when not in use?

When not in use, store your SRH840 headphones in the provided carrying pouch to protect them from dust and physical damage. Make sure the cable is not twisted or under tension.

Are the Shure SRH840 headphones compatible with mobile devices?

Yes, the Shure SRH840 headphones are compatible with most mobile devices that have a 3.5mm audio jack or adapter. Check your device specifications to ensure compatibility.

What should I do if one ear cup of my Shure SRH840 headphones is not working?

If one ear cup is not working, first check the audio source and cable connections. Swap the cable if possible to rule out a cable issue. If the problem persists, contact Shure customer support for further assistance.

How do I replace the cable on my Shure SRH840 headphones?

To replace the cable, unplug the existing cable from the ear cup. Insert the new cable by aligning the connectors and pushing until it clicks securely into place.
